Unlocking Quality: Color Sorting Machines for Rice, Beans & More
In today's competitive market, delivering premium quality is paramount. For grains like rice and beans, achieving this means eliminating impurities with precision. This is where color sorting machines step in, revolutionizing the industry by providing a reliable solution for securing purity. These sophisticated systems use advanced technology to distinguish different colors within a product, separating unwanted elements from the high-quality grains. The result? A significantly refined product that meets the demanding standards of consumers worldwide.
Beyond this, color sorting machines offer a range of perks. They maximize yield by retrieving otherwise lost product, reduce contamination risks, and ensure standardized quality across batches. By investing in color sorting technology, businesses can optimize their operations, lower costs, and ultimately, provide a product that exceeds expectations.
Precision Grain Inspection and Grading with Cutting-Edge Technology
The agricultural industry is undergoing a transformation fueled by innovative technologies. One such advancement is automated grain inspection and grading, which leverages sophisticated sensors and algorithms to efficiently assess the quality of grains.{Automated systems can examine various parameters such as size, shape, color, and moisture content with unprecedented precision. This minimizes the need for manual inspection, which can be time-consuming.
- Furthermore, automated systems deliver real-time data, allowing farmers and manufacturers to make informed decisions.
- Consequently, grain quality is improved, leading to higher yields.
Additionally, the integration of artificial intelligence (AI) and machine learning enables continuous improvement of grain inspection algorithms, generating even greater detail in assessments.
Boosting Tea Quality: Precise Color Sorting for Superior Grades
Precise color sorting has revolutionized the tea industry, enabling producers to maximize tea quality and attain superior grades. By pinpointing subtle color variations in leaf batches, advanced sorting systems can separate various types of tea based on their attributes. This method results in more refined blends that exhibit a uniform color and presentation.
The benefits of precise color sorting are manifold. It improves the overall flavor of tea by eliminating imperfect leaves that can detract from the flavor profile. Furthermore, it elevates yield and reduces waste by optimizing every segment of the tea harvest. As a result, manufacturers can provide higher-quality tea that meets the requirements of discerning consumers worldwide.
Ultimately, precise color sorting is an essential tool for securing excellence in the tea industry. By utilizing this technology, producers can guarantee a exceptional product that delights tea lovers everywhere.
